    Abstract: A cover assembly is provided for preventing water infiltration into an in-floor receptacle fitting, such as a poke-thru fitting. The cover assembly includes a trim flange which overlies the fitting and is adapted to support at least one receptacle within the fitting. A cover plate is mounted on the trim flange includes access doors for selectively covering and exposing the receptacles. A first seal member is interposed between the cover plate and the trim flange for sealing against water infiltration therebetween. The first seal may be in the form of a planar gasket or O-ring. A second seal, in the form of at least one compressible gasket, extends around the perimeter of the floor opening and is adapted to be compressed between the trim flange and the surface of the floor. The cover plate may also include top and bottom portions and a third seal member interposed between the top and bottom portions.

    Abstract: A wire protection grommet is constructed for installation in a wire pull opening in the cell of a cellular raceway. The grommet is sized for insertion through the wire pull opening and defines central passages extending through the opening. The central passage has a radiused portion defining a wire pull strain relief to prevent wires that pass through the grommet from being bent beyond a predetermined bend radius. The grommet is constructed to lockingly engage into the wire pull opening so that it is not displaced during use. The distal end of the grommet may be weighted so that the grommet correctly orients itself in the opening during installation. The grommet may also include a wire storage section around which excess wiring can be wrapped. Hooks may be provided for retaining the excess wire on the wire storage section. The grommet may include an opening or slot which extends to the central passage and which is sized to permit wires to be slid into the passage.

    Abstract: An access cover for an in-floor receptacle fitting includes a door mounting member connectable to the fitting at a location that overlies the receptacles carried by the fitting. A pair of access doors are slidably connected to the door mounting member for movement between closed positions at which the doors abut one another and overlie the at least one receptacle, and open positions at which the doors are laterally spaced from one another and the at least one receptacle is exposed. A seal member is adapted to seal against moisture infiltration between the access doors when the access doors are at their closed positions. The seal member may include a compressible seal carried by at least one of the access doors. Preferably the compressible seal members are carried by each of the access doors and are positioned to abut one another when the doors are at their closed positions. The compressible seals may be formed from a compressible polymer that is co-molded with the access doors.

    Abstract: An access cover for a receptacle fitting includes a cover plate connectable to the fitting at a location overlying a receptacle carried by the fitting. An access door includes a first portion slidably connected to the cover plate for movement between open and closed positions. The access door also includes a second portion having a first end pivotally connected to the access door first portion. The second end of the door second portion pivots to a first position overlying the receptacle in response to movement of the access door first portion towards its closed position, and pivots to a second position at which the receptacle is exposed and accessible through the cover plate in response to movement of the access door first portion towards its open position. Pivot features are formed on the cover plate and/or the access door for imparting rotational forces on the door second portion as the door first portion is slid between its open and closed positions.

    Abstract: An apparatus and method for protecting integrated circuits from electrical overstress and eletrostatic discharge is provided. The apparatus includes a primary EOS/ESD protection device and a feedback circuit. The feedback circuit maintain the primary EOS/ESD protection device in an off state during normal operation of the integrated circuit and switches the primary protection device to an state when an EOS/ESD event occurs at a first input pad with respect to a second input pad of the integrated circuit.

    Abstract: An apparatus and method for protecting semiconductor switching devices from damage due to electrostatic discharge is provided. The apparatus detects the occurrence of an ESD event, and turns the switching circuit to an operating state in which electrostatic charge is dissipated through the switching circuit. In embodiments of the invention, the switching circuit is a CMOS inverter circuit and the apparatus includes a PMOS transistor that upon occurrence of an ESD event couples an output of the inverter circuit to ground to discharge the electrostatic charge.
